Gunmen in Nigeria have kidnapped more than 220 students and teachers from a local school, causing widespread concern and fear across the country. This tragic event adds to a series of similar kidnappings that have troubled Nigeria’s education system and security forces.
The attackers targeted the school with the specific intention of abducting children and staff, leading to a swift response from Nigerian authorities. Efforts are now underway to rescue the kidnapped individuals and secure their safe return.
